Demolition Zoning Development Permit in Woodland Park, Colorado

Required City ZDP for demolishing a structure in Woodland Park, listed among the project types the Planning and Building Department's ZDP process covers.

Reviewed 2026-07-19 · Source

When you need this permit

  • Demolition of a structure within Woodland Park city limits requires an approved ZDP before work begins
  • Property owner's signature required prior to submittal, consistent with the City's other ZDP application forms

Fee schedule

Demolition2026 Zoning Application & Development Fees, revised 1/1/2026.
$68.00

    Woodland Park, Colorado has adopted: 2023 Pikes Peak Regional Building Code (PPRBC) — per PPRBD's Residential Plan Review guide, which lists the City of Woodland Park among the jurisdictions served by the Pikes Peak Regional Building Code.; 2021 International Residential Code (IRC); 2021 International Existing Building Code (IEBC); 2021 International Energy Conservation Code (IECC); Colorado Model Electric Ready and Solar Ready Code (CMERSRC); 2021 International Swimming Pool and Spa Code (ISPSC); 2023 National Electrical Code (NEC), or the most recent edition adopted by the State of Colorado, per PPRBD's Residential Plan Review guide; International Fire Code (IFC) and local amendments — enforced by the local Fire Authority (a distinct authority from PPRBD), per PPRBD's Residential Plan Review guide; City of Woodland Park Municipal Code Title 18 (Zoning), which separately governs Zoning Development Permit review (setbacks, fencing, signs, etc.) and is administered by the City's own Planning and Building Department rather than PPRBD.. Local amendments apply — see the Woodland Park overview page for the full list.
